1.1 About The SOA Strategy Planning Tool
What is the purpose of the tool?
The SOA strategy planning tool helps you to understand where your organisation is within its SOA initiative. Through the use of an interactive questionnaire, it assesses your organisation's SOA capabilities in six critical dimensions:
- Understanding of key SOA concepts
- Current business and IT strategies and associated governance processes
- Architecture processes
- Organisation structure and skills
- Governance of the service lifecycle
- Technology capabilities.

Why would I use this tool, rather than tools provided by vendors?
Many of the SOA suppliers offer free assessment and planning tools. In some cases, these tools are primarily focused on assessment and although they will help you to understand your level of SOA maturity, they do not offer the actionable advice to help you plan your SOA initiative given your level of maturity. In other cases, the assessment tool also includes a planning element. However, in such cases the tools are likely to be oriented to the supplier's offerings, which in most cases will not be sufficiently broad to support a comprehensive SOA initiative.
Our tool combines assessment and planning, and provides a vendor-independent and holistic perspective on SOA which considers the broad range of capabilities and technologies required to maximise the value of your investment in SOA. How does it work?
The personalised action plan is produced using a model which maps your scores in each assessment section and subsection to a database of actions. The model also understands dependencies and relationships between sections, subsections and questions, and takes those into account when generating the action plan.
